Closed3
memo @240211*
Unpic
Next.js
を使ってたらnext/image
を使えるけどもそのいろんな環境に使えるバージョン。
Remix
にもImage
コンポーネントはなかった気がする。素のReact
使ってるときも簡単に画像最適化できるし良さそう。
Next.js
のApp Router
を使ってるブログ
Million 3
Million.js
はReact
の仮想DOM (Virtual DOM)
の概念を採用しつつ、
パフォーマンスと効率性を更に向上させることを目的としたJavaScript
ライブラリ。
React
を使っててパフォーマンスが遅いと感じることはあまりないけれども、
速いに越したことはないとReact
内部の仮想DOM
の仕組みをより良くしたもの。
// Normally, React SSR will traverse every node in the component (👎 ❌)
<div>
<h1>Hello, world!</h1>
<button onClick={handleClick}>{count}</button>
</div>
// Million 3 only hydrates `handleClick` and `count` (✨ ✅)
<div>
<h1>Hello, world!</h1>
<button onClick={handleClick}>{count}</button>
</div>
素のReact
だとサーバーサイドレンダリングするときにハイドレーション(JS処理などのアタッチ)の対象が全体であるのに対しMillion.js
なら動的な部分のみを対象とできる。
このスクラップは2024/02/12にクローズされました